| 释义 | no-knead adjective
 (alsono knead)uk /ˈnəʊˌniːd/ us /ˈnoʊˌniːd/
 No-knead bread is made without kneading(= pressing with your hands) the dough during preparation:
 This no-knead bread is as good and as easy as everyone says.
 Try this no-knead recipe.
 I used plain flour in the no knead bread recipe.
 One of our favourite recipes is the no-knead brioche.
 This recipe is another variation on his no-knead method.
 If you really want a good sourdough, a no-knead loaf will never satisfy.
